According to the FDA Adverse Event Reporting System (FAERS), 233 reports of Type 2 diabetes mellitus have been filed in association with ARIPIPRAZOLE (Aripiprazole). This represents 0.4% of all adverse event reports for ARIPIPRAZOLE.

How Dangerous Is Type 2 diabetes mellitus From ARIPIPRAZOLE?
Of the 233 reports, 16 (6.9%) resulted in death, 84 (36.1%) required hospitalization, and 6 (2.6%) were considered life-threatening.
Is Type 2 diabetes mellitus Listed in the Official Label?
This adverse event is not currently listed in the official FDA drug label for ARIPIPRAZOLE. However, 233 reports have been filed with the FAERS database.
